Palo Alto panel approves concept for generative artwork 'Loam' at 975 Page Mill Road
Summary
The Palo Alto Public Art Commission approved a concept for 'Loam,' a screen-based generative animation by artist Daniel Conagher, to be sited in the lobby of the Link at 975 Page Mill Road. The commission approved the concept unanimously; ongoing maintenance will be the property owner’s responsibility, not the art budget.
The Palo Alto Public Art Commission on Nov. 20 approved the concept for a generative digital artwork titled Loam to be installed in the lobby of the Link, a remodeled building at 975 Page Mill Road meant to serve early-stage entrepreneurs.
Jamie Jarvis, programs director for Stanford Research Park, presented the Link project and introduced the project team and artist.
